About Sage Performance Taper II Fly Line - Weight Forward, Floating
Closeouts. Built to excel with the actions of premium rods, Sage Performance Taper II fly line has a fine tuned loading system for smooth handling.
- High floating line for great feel and reliable presentations
- Weight forward

Specs about Sage Performance Taper II Fly Line - Weight Forward, Floating
- Type: Weight forward
- Material: Polyurethane
- Length: 90'
- Recommended use: Freshwater
